CONSISTENT FORCE. Jarod Requinton (right) of Criss Cross scores against Louie Ramirez of Cignal during their Spikers’ Turf Open Conference match at Ynares Sports Arena in Pasig on March 14, 2025. His impressive games helped the King Crunchers reach the semifinals. (PVL photo)
MANILA – Criss Cross hitter Jaron Requinton was voted Player of the Week Monday for his outstanding performance in the 2025 Spikers’ Turf Open Conference.
The former University of Santo Tomas beach volleyball standout scored nine points in their 25-12, 25-18, 25-22 win over VNS-Laticrete last Wednesday, the had 18 points when the King Crunchers stunned the defending champion Cignal HD Spikers, 19-25, 25-14, 25-20, 25-19, the following day.
The 24-year-old capped off the week with a career-best 22 points, built on 15 attacks, five kill blocks, and two service aces, as Criss Cross pulled off a 20-25, 25-13, 24-26, 25-19, 15-11 victory over Savouge on Sunday as they stayed perfect after nine outings.
Requinton won weekly (March 12 to 16) award handed out by reporters covering the league, beating teammates Jude Garcia and Ish Polvorosa, CJ Segui of VNS, Steven Rotter of Cignal, and Mark Calado of Savouge
“Of course, I'm also proud of myself that the hard work I put into training seems to be paying off now," the 6-foot-2 Requinton said in a news release.
“The things the coaches worked hard to build in me in training, but now I can go out on the court no matter who the opponent is. I really don't want to disappoint them with the performance I put out every game,” he added.
Requinton said their victories over Cignal and Savouge boosted their confidence heading into the semifinals.
“It also boosts our morale and at the same time, we must also learn not to be complacent. Because when the semis come, it will all be gone, everything will be back to zero," he added.
Criss Cross will face PGJC-Navy on Wednesday before shifting its focus to the round-robin semifinals. (PNA)
